  1. Christian Branches in Europe Protestant denominations, Catholicism, and Eastern Orthodoxy are dominant in different regions of Europe—a result of many historic interactions. Where is each branch of Christianity predominant in Europe?

  2. Christian Branches in the U.S. Shaded areas are counties with more than 50% of church membership concentrated in Roman Catholicism or one of the Protestant denominations.Where are the Catholics? Where are the Baptists? Where are the Lutherans? Where are the Mormons? Where are the Methodists?

  3. Diffusion of Islam Fig. 6-6: Islam diffused rapidly and widely from its area of origin in Arabia. It eventually stretched from southeast Asia to West Africa.

  4. Islam by Branch Islam, the religion of 1.3 billion people, is the predominant religion of the Middle East from North Africa to Central Asia. 83% are Sunnis. 16% are Shiite. 40% of all Shiites live in Iran.

  5. Diffusion of Buddhism Fig. 6-7: Buddhism diffused gradually from its origin in northeastern India to Sri Lanka, southeast Asia, and eventually China and Japan.

  6. Diffusion of Sikhism & Baha’I • Baha ‘I has diffused in notable numbers to Africa and Asia. • Sikhism has not diffused much and remains concentrated in the Punjab of India.

  8. Distribution of Ethnic Religions • Animism • Amazon, Reservations of N. America, Louisiana/New Orleans, Caribbean, Africa, Central Asia, Pacific, Australia. • Confucianism • China, Southeast Asia, Far East. • Daoism • China • Shinto • Japan • Hinduism • India • Judaism • (Breaks the rule b/c of the Diaspora) North America, Europe, Israel.

  9. Shinto and Buddhism in Japan Since Japanese can be both Shinto and Buddhist, there are many areas in Japan where over two-thirds of the population are both Shinto and Buddhist.Christianity has blended with Animism in Africa.

  10. Jewish Diaspora • Judaism is an Ethnic religion that has a widespread distribution because of the Diaspora of the 1st century A.D. Persecution has lead to support of Zionism, the Jewish movement back to Israel.
